Ingredients and spices that need to be Take to make Toovar dal:
- 3/4 cup toovar dal (washed and drained)
- 1/4 cup chopped tomatoes
- 1 slit green chilli
- 1/2 tsp turmeric powder
- 1 tbsp ghee
- 1/2 tsp cumin seeds
- 1/4 tsp asafoetida
- 4 curry leaves
- to taste Salt
Steps to make to make Toovar dal
- Soak the toor dal in enough water for an hour.
- After half an hour, drain the dal using a strainer.
- In a pressure cooker,add washed and drained dal.
- Add tomatoes, green chilli, turmeric powder and 2 cups water in a pressure cooker.
- Mix well and pressure cook for 3 whistles.
- Allow the steam to escape before opening the lid.
- Stir the dal once so there are no lumps and remove the slit green chilli.
- Add 1 cup of water to adjust the consistency of toover dal and salt.
- Whisk well and keep aside.
- Heat the ghee in a deep non-stick pan.
- Once the oil is hot,add cumin seeds.
- Add asafetida,curry leaves and saute on a medium flame for 30 seconds.
- Add dal mixture and mix well.
- Cook on a medium flame for 3 to 4 minutes, while stirring occasionally.
- Serve toover dal hot with steamed rice or roti.
